Unique Silver Coin: Lunar II Year of the Horse 2014
The 2014 Year of the Horse coin is a true gem in the world of precious metals, representing the seventh and highly acclaimed installment of the famous Australian Lunar II bullion and collector series. Weighing one kilogram (1000 g) of pure 999 silver, it combines impressive weight with the masterful craftsmanship characteristic of the world-class Perth Mint. The craftsmanship and precision of The Perth Mint
The Perth Mint, responsible for the issue, is synonymous with the highest quality of bullion coin minting. The obverse of this silver coin is traditionally adorned with the effigy of Queen Elizabeth II, surrounded by the necessary inscriptions regarding the country, denomination, and year of issue. The reverse focuses entirely on a symbolic representation of the zodiac Horse in a dynamic pose, paying tribute to the culture of the Chinese lunar calendar. This precise and beautiful illustration is the main element that attracts the attention of both numismatists and investors who appreciate aesthetics combined with high precious metal content.
